New Blackfalds arena to be named Eagle Builders Centre
The Town of Blackfalds has announced that the newly expanded arena and library will be named the “Eagle Builders Centre.”
“It is an honour to team up with a leading company and major contributor such as Eagle Builders who is also a partner in the construction of the new arena,” said Mayor Richard Poole.
Eagle Builders is locally based in Blackfalds/Lacombe County and is an innovator in the engineering, fabrication, and building of precast concrete structures. They have been a long-standing member of the community that employs over 275 area residents.
The new 1,300 seat arena will include a second ice surface, a 12,000 sq. ft. library, multi-purpose rooms, and the future home of the Blackfalds Bulldogs Junior ‘A’ hockey club.
